Devotion

Effective period / Period of releases: 1994

Members: Hans Olav Grøttheim, James Ekgren, Cecilie Hafstad Richards

Norwegian Euro-dance group consisting of singer Silya (Cecilie Hafstad), rapper Jimmy James (James Ekgren) and producer Hans Olav Grøttheim (formerly of YBU and Photon, later a producer for Norwegian pop acts such as Sissel Kyrkjebø and Espen Lind). Devotion released two singles during 1994-95 through Dance Pool. "Makes Me Feel" was a hit in Norway in 1994 and stayed 10 weeks on the national chart (VG-lista), peaking at no. 3, but it failed to make much of an impression internationally. The follow-up "Move Me" saw some radio play nationally but was less successful in the charts than their debut single. An album was planned for release, and a teaser for the album called "Higher" appeared on the "More Music 4" compilation in 1995. However, Silya left the group a few months later. The project was then discontinued, and the album remains unreleased.
